a{color:#333;}
.container{width:1170px;}
.mt10{margin-top:10px;}
.mt15{margin-top:15px;}
.mb10{margin-bottom:10px;}
.mb15{margin-bottom:15px;}

.qrcodex{position:relative;z-index:2;}
.qrcodex:hover .qrcodex-box{display:block;}
.qrcodex .qrcodex-box{
    display:none;
    position: absolute;
    background: #fff;
    border: 1px solid #666;
    padding: 0 10px;
    text-align: center;
}
.qrcodex .qrcodex-box .img{
    width: 150px;
    height: 150px;
    margin: 10px auto 0 auto;
    background: url(../images/wxqrcode.png) no-repeat 0 0;
}
.site-top-nav .qrcodex .qrcodex-box{top:36px;right:0;border-top:0;}
.sidenav .qrcodex .qrcodex-box{bottom:0;right:41px;}
.sidenav .qrcodex .qrcodex-box .img{margin-bottom:10px;}
.sidenav .qrcodex .qrcodex-box .text{display:none;}

.site-top-nav{height:36px;z-index:2;}
.site-top-nav .container{height:36px;line-height:36px;font-size:12px;}
.site-top-nav a:hover{color:#c00;}
.site-top-nav .left{float:left;}
.site-top-nav .right{float:right;}
.site-top-nav .left li{float:left;}
.site-top-nav .right li{float:right;}
.site-top-nav .last{border:0;}
.site-top-nav li span{
    margin-left: 15px;
    padding-right: 15px;
    border-left: 1px solid #777;
    display: inline-block;_zoom:1;*display:inline;
    height: 10px;
}

.follow-left{width:110px;position:absolute;top:0;left:50%;margin-left:-585px}
.follow-left.fixed{position:fixed;top:10px;z-index:2;}
.follow-left ul{text-align:center;}
.follow-left ul li{width:110px;}
.follow-left ul li a{
    display:block;height:40px;line-height:40px;border-radius:4px;
    margin-bottom:2px;white-space:nowrap;overflow:hidden;
    font-size:16px;text-decoration:none;
}
.follow-left ul li a:hover,
.follow-left ul li a.active{background-color:#b23231;color:#fff;}
.follow-left ul li.submenu{
    position:relative;z-index:3;
}
.follow-left ul li.submenu .mtitle{
    background-image:url(../images/arrow_right.png);
    background-repeat:no-repeat;
    background-position:80px center;
}
.follow-left ul li.submenu ul{
    position:absolute;bottom:0;left:110px;
    border:1px solid #ddd;background:#fff;padding:6px 0;width:238px;
    overflow:hidden;zoom:1;display:none;
    box-shadow: 4px 4px 0 rgba(0,0,0,0.1);
    z-index:4;
}
.follow-left ul li.submenu ul li{
    float:left;margin-left:6px;_margin-left:3px;
}

.news-logo{
    width:110px;height:39px;
    margin-bottom:12px;display:block;
    background: url(../images/logo_small.gif) no-repeat 0 0;
}
@media only screen and (-webkit-min-device-pixel-ratio: 1.5),
       only screen and (min--moz-device-pixel-ratio: 1.5),
       only screen and (-o-min-device-pixel-ratio: 3/2),
       only screen and (min-device-pixel-ratio: 1.5) {
    .news-logo {
        background-image: url(../images/logo-big.gif);
        background-size: 110px 39px;
    }
}

.sidenav{position:fixed;bottom:50px;left:50%;margin-left:588px;z-index:2;}
.sidenav li{margin-bottom:2px;position:relative;z-index:3;}
.sidenav li,
.sidenav li a{
    display:block;width:40px;height:40px;line-height:40px;text-align:center;
}
.sidenav a{
    background:#ffa5a4 url(../images/home_sidenav.png) no-repeat 0 0;
    color:#fefefe;font-size:12px;
    text-decoration:none;
    text-indent:-1000em;
    border-radius:2px;
    /*    transition: all .3s ease-in-out;
        -ms-transition: all .3s ease-in-out;
        -moz-transition: all .3s ease-in-out;
        -webkit-transition: all .3s ease-in-out;
        -o-transition: all .3s ease-in-out;*/
}
.sidenav .refresh a{background-position:center 0;}
.sidenav .top a{background-position:center -40px;}
.sidenav .weixin a{background-position:center -80px;}
.sidenav .top{display:none;}
.sidenav a:hover{background:#b23231;text-indent:0;}
.ie6 .sidenav{display:none;}

.image img{
    -webkit-transition: all .4s;
    -moz-transition: all .4s;
    -ms-transition: all .4s;
    -o-transition: all .4s;
    transition: all .4s;
}
.image img:hover{
    -webkit-transform: scale(1.1);
    -moz-transform: scale(1.1);
    -o-transform: scale(1.1);
    -ms-transform: scale(1.1);
    transform: scale(1.1);
}


.sub-nav{height: 36px;margin-bottom:15px;}
.sub-nav .inner{
    font-size:16px;
    height:36px;line-height:36px;
    border-bottom:2px solid #eee;
}
.sub-nav ul li{margin-right:18px;display:inline-block;_zoom:1;*display:inline;}
.sub-nav ul li:last-child{margin-right:0;}
.sub-nav ul li.active{border-bottom:2px solid #b23231;}
.sub-nav .inner.fixed{
    position: fixed;
    top: 0;
    background-color: #fff;
    border-color: #ddd;
    width: 664px;
    z-index: 2;
    text-align: center;
    -webkit-transition: top .3s ease-out .1s;
    transition: top .3s ease-out .1s;
}

/* 鐒︾偣鍥� */
.main-slide{
    width:100%;height:280px;margin-bottom:15px;overflow:hidden;position:relative;background:#000
}
.main-slide .hd{
    height:0px; width:100%;
    position:absolute; left:0; right:0px; bottom:-28px;
    z-index:1; overflow:visible;
}
.main-slide .hd ul{overflow:hidden; zoom:1;position: absolute;bottom: 38px;right: 17px;}
.main-slide .hd ul li{
    width:12px;height:12px;border-radius:100%;margin-left:6px;background:#ddd;float:left;
    cursor:pointer;
}
.main-slide .hd ul li span{
    display:block; width:245px; padding:0 10px;
    height:48px; line-height:48px; text-align:center;  zoom:1;
    cursor:pointer;
    border-bottom:1px solid #262626; overflow:hidden; white-space:nowrap;
}
.main-slide .hd ul li span a{color:#8d8d8d}
.main-slide .hd ul li.on{
    background:#b73737;
    /*    transition: all .3s ease-in-out;
        -ms-transition: all .3s ease-in-out;
        -moz-transition: all .3s ease-in-out;
        -webkit-transition: all .3s ease-in-out;
        -o-transition: all .3s ease-in-out;
        border-radius: 6px;width:20px;*/
}
.main-slide .hd ul li.on a{ color:#d69b9b}
.main-slide .bd{position:relative; height:100%; width:100%; margin:0px; z-index:0; background:#000;}
.main-slide .bd a{display:block;}
.main-slide .bd li{ zoom:1; vertical-align:middle;display:none;}
.main-slide .bd li img{background:url(../images/loading36-black.gif) no-repeat center center;}
.main-slide .bd li span{
    position:absolute; bottom:0; left:0px; 
    cursor:pointer; right:0; z-index:2; color:#fff;
    font-size: 20px; _width:100%; display:block; padding:5px 15px;
    background: -moz-linear-gradient(top,  rgba(0,0,0,0) 0%, rgba(19,19,19,1) 100%); /* FF3.6+ */
    background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,rgba(0,0,0,0)), color-stop(100%,rgba(19,19,19,1))); /* Chrome,Safari4+ */
    background: -webkit-linear-gradient(top,  rgba(0,0,0,0) 0%,rgba(19,19,19,1) 100%); /* Chrome10+,Safari5.1+ */
    background: -o-linear-gradient(top,  rgba(0,0,0,0) 0%,rgba(19,19,19,1) 100%); /* Opera 11.10+ */
    background: -ms-linear-gradient(top,  rgba(0,0,0,0) 0%,rgba(19,19,19,1) 100%); /* IE10+ */
    background: linear-gradient(to bottom,  rgba(0,0,0,0) 0%,rgba(19,19,19,1) 100%); /* W3C */
    fil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#00000000', endColorstr='#131313',GradientType=0 ); /* IE6-9 */
}
.main-slide .bd img{width:100%;height:280px;display:block;}
.main-slide .prev,
.main-slide .next{
    position:absolute; left:0; top:-210px; display:block; *display:inline-block; width:35px; height:60px;
    background:url(../images/slider-arrow.png?v2) 0 0 no-repeat;
    /*opacity:0.7;filter:alpha(opacity=70);*/
}
.main-slide .next{left:auto;right:0;background-position:-49px 0;}
.main-slide .prev:hover{
    background-position:-99px 0;
}
.main-slide .next:hover{
    background-position:-143px 0;
}
.main-slide .prevStop{ display:none;}
.main-slide .nextStop{ display:none;}


.main-area{overflow:hidden;zoom:1;margin-top:15px;position:relative;}
.main-area .left{float:left;width:664px;margin-left:140px;_display:inline;}
.main-area .right{float:right;width:336px;}
.ie6 .main-area .right{overflow:hidden;}

.main-area .loading{
    display:none;margin-bottom:15px;
    font-size:14px;color:#fff;height:32px;line-height:32px;text-align:center;
    background-color:#60a3f5;
    background-color: rgba(96,163,245,.85);
}
.main-area .info-flow li{
    width:100%;overflow:hidden;zoom:1;
    margin-bottom:12px;padding-bottom:12px;border-bottom:1px solid #eee;
}
.main-area .info-flow li:hover{}
.main-area .info-flow li.baidu{padding-bottom:0;height:92px;overflow:hidden;}
.main-area .info-flow li .image{
    float:left;margin-right:15px;
}
.main-area .info-flow li .image.last{margin-right:0;}
.main-area .info-flow li .image,
.main-area .info-flow li .image img,
.main-area .info-flow li .image a{width:142px;height:80px;overflow:hidden;display:block;}
.main-area .info-flow li .content{
    width:496px;height:80px;
    float:left;position:relative;
}
.main-area .info-flow li .content .inner{
    position: absolute;
    top: 50%;
    transform: translate(0, -50%);
    -webkit-transform: translate(0, -50%);
    -ms-transform: translate(0, -50%);
    width:100%;
}
.lte-ie8 .main-area .info-flow li .content .inner{
    position:initial;top:0;transform:none;
}
/*.main-area .info-flow li .content .inner a:visited{color:#999;}*/
.main-area .info-flow li h2{
    display: block;
    font-size: 20px;
    line-height: 1.3;
    margin-bottom: 4px;
    font-weight: 700;
    max-height: 52px;
    display: -webkit-box;
    -webkit-box-orient: vertical;
    -webkit-line-clamp: 2;
    overflow: hidden;
    text-overflow: ellipsis;
}
.main-area .info-flow li .info{font-size:12px;color:#bbb;margin-top:4px;}
.main-area .info-flow li .info i,
.main-area .info-flow li .info a,
.main-area .info-flow li .info em{
    font-style:normal;
    border: 1px solid #eee;
    border-radius: 3px;
    padding: 2px 6px;
    color: #bbb;
}
.main-area .info-flow li .info i{margin-right:3px;}
.main-area .info-flow li .info a:hover{
    border-color: #d28786;
    color: #d28786;
}
.main-area .info-flow li .info span{margin-left:10px;}
.main-area .info-flow li.nopic .image{display:none;}
.main-area .info-flow li.nopic .content{width:649px;}
.main-area .info-flow li.single{
    position:relative;
}
.main-area .info-flow li.single .image,
.main-area .info-flow li.single .image img,
.main-area .info-flow li.single .image a{width:100%;height:auto;clear:both;}
.main-area .info-flow li.single img{margin-right:0;}
.main-area .info-flow li.single,
.main-area .info-flow li.group{position:relative;*padding-bottom:5px;}
.main-area .info-flow li.single h2,
.main-area .info-flow li.group h2{display:block;margin-bottom:10px;}
.main-area .info-flow li.single .tuig,
.main-area .info-flow li.group .tuig{
    position: absolute;
    bottom: 12px;
    left: 0px;
    font-size: 12px;
    color: #666;
    background: #fff;
    opacity: 0.8;
    height: 16px;
    line-height: 16px;
    padding: 0px 3px;
    text-align: center;
    z-index: 1;
    border-top-right-radius: 3px;
}
.main-area .list-img li{height:155px;}
.main-area .list-img li span{background:none;}
.main-area .list-img li .rttxt{
    overflow:hidden;
    height: 40px;
    line-height: 20px;
    font-size: 14px;
    text-align:left;
}
.main-area .list-img li:hover .rttxt{color:#b23231;}
.main-area .list-top10 .list-item li{border-color:#eee;}

#follow-right{width:336px;}
